In 1971, helicopter pilot Captain Jack Higgins, stationed in Vietnam, flies stateside as a funeral escort for his fallen Marine Corps brother. The official cause of death is from enemy fire, but the actual cause is selective scheduling. The perpetrator, Lt.Col. Fred Bedford, has so far eliminated four Marine brothers. With only three left, Jack vows revenge against Bedford, the military, and their treatment back home. He’s going to execute the biggest heist in military history: the $20 million payroll on Okinawa. Jack is assigned to the money run, the helicopter carrying all of the small, unmarked bills. His brothers, with motives of their own, join forces with him. All is well with the plan until he meets Air Force Captain Ellen Stevens and falls in love. Now he’s torn. Can he take the money and still keep Ellen? He has eight weeks to figure it out. P.R. Steele flew as a pilot in the CH 53 helicopter for the Marine Corps in Vietnam, and has firsthand experience flying the money run on Okinawa. He retired from the Corps with 27 years of service on active duty and the reserves. He lives in northern California and enjoys tinkering on old cars, writing and avoiding work.
